- The distance between Munich, Germany and Dalatangi, Iceland is approximately 2,401 km or 1,492 mi.
- To reach Munich in this distance one would set out from Dalatangi bearing 129.2°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Munich bearing 150.8° or SSE .
- Munich has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Dalatangi has a tundra climate (ET).
- Munich is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Dalatangi is in or near the subpolar rain tundra biome.
- The annual average temperature is 4.3 °C (7.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.3 °C (20.3°F) more in Munich.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 604.5 mm (23.8 in) less which is equivalent to 604.5 l/m² (14.84 US gal/ft²) or 6,045,000 l/ha (646,251 US gal/ac) less. About 4/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.9° higher in Munich than in Dalatangi.
- Relative humidity levels are 0.9%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 3.9°C (6.9°F) higher.
